Azithromycin is highly bioavailable after being administered per os (PO) in dogs (97%), and only moderately bioavailable in cats (58%) and humans Data are geometric means with ranges in parentheses. Azithromycin is often used for upper respiratory tract infections, but it is important to remember that a large majority of upper respiratory infections in cats are caused by viruses like herpesvirus and calicivirus, not by bacteria. In cats, Cryptosporidium spp. The only approved treatment for coccidiosis in the United States is sulfadimethoxine administered at 5060 mg/kg daily for 520 days (dogs and cats). In cats, C. felis is most common and is transmitted between cats by the ingestion of feces from mutual grooming, shared litterboxes, ingestion of contaminated food or water, and possibly, ingestion of infected prey species. In cats, it is used off-label to treat upper respiratory infections, bartonellosis, cryptosporidiosis, toxoplasmosis, or in combination with atovaquone to treat cytauxzoonosis.
